Output 3f58ec06a8aec76f514ecf9d569b1dbb8d7b1e2c9f622bd407a6a9a0f1c703d4:1

value
1428158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e9779019414edc4670712cc2369d58ebd7592d OP_EQUAL
address
33sT9XiMXRjJtTkWssggxuKQ4m6qDibARP
transaction
3f58ec06a8aec76f514ecf9d569b1dbb8d7b1e2c9f622bd407a6a9a0f1c703d4
confirmations
280491
spent
true